Meet Molekule

Soft white cylinders, glowing humidity controls, and long explanations about airborne particles give Molekule the feel of a science-forward wellness brand for the home. The company sells premium air purifiers and humidifiers built around its proprietary PECO filtration approach, blending HEPA, carbon, and light-activated technology with app-connected controls and medical-device positioning.

Molekule presents itself as a company shaped by concern over indoor air pollution and respiratory health. Its public story centers on Dr. Yogi Goswami’s research into photo electrochemical oxidation technology and a family effort to turn that research into consumer air purification products.

Over time, the brand expanded from home air purifiers into FDA-cleared medical-use devices, then merged with AeroClean Technologies in 2023 under the MKUL, Inc. umbrella. Across its site, Molekule consistently frames clean air as both a scientific challenge and a daily quality-of-life issue, especially for families, allergy sufferers, and shared indoor spaces.
